再検討 is the most general and formal term for re-examination, often used in business or official contexts. 見直し implies a review with the aim of improvement or correction, and is common in both formal and everyday settings. 再考 is specifically about reconsidering a decision or opinion, and is often used when asking someone to rethink something.
English 're-examination' can cover many situations, but Japanese uses different compounds depending on what is being re-examined. Using 再検討 for a medical test would sound unnatural; use 再検査 instead.
